ORANGE CRATE LABEL SERIES:
THE UNAUTHORIZED HISTORY OF
BASEBALL IN 100-ODD PAINTINGS

When he returned to his Orange Crate Label Series in 1994, Ben Sakoguchi included a few baseball-themed paintings, and would add several more in later years, forming a core of about 20 works.

In 2004, Sakoguchi began a dedicated look at how the game of baseball, which has long been referred to as America's National Pastime, has reflected the quirks of American culture.   He finished 120 new baseball canvases for the 2006 "Winter Ball" exhibition at Los Angeles City College, and is continuing to work on The Unauthorized History of Baseball in 100-odd Paintings.

The 140 paintings reproduced here date from 1994 to 2005.   They are acrylic on canvas, 10 inches x 11 inches.
